Shri Vilas Sopan Wadekar has been appointed as the Chairman and Managing Director of Mumbai Railway Vikas Corporation (MRVC), succeeding Shri Subhash Chand Gupta. A 1991 batch Indian Railway Service of Engineers officer, Shri Wadekar brings over three decades of expertise in railway infrastructure and suburban network development to his new leadership role.
Recognized for his exceptional technical expertise, Shri Wadekar was impaneled as a Joint Secretary to the Government of India in 2019. With over 15 years of experience in Mumbai’s suburban railway network, he has played a crucial role in planning and executing large-scale infrastructure projects, including civil, electrical, and signaling works. His leadership is expected to drive MRVC’s mission of modernizing Mumbai’s suburban rail network and enhancing commuter services.
